Factory Options: 1) Manual steering 2) Power DISC front brakes 3) Dual exhaust 4) Power Convertible top 6) Bucket seats w/floor shift 7) #s MATCHING 302ci 2V motor 8) Upgraded 4 Speed manual Transmission (formerly 3 speed) 9) Remote Mirror 10) Stock Polished Aluminum wheels with radial tires. 11) 3.00:1 rear axle ratio 12) Front and rear spoilers 13) Mach I appearance package The car comes from Illinois, where it has been collector owned and maintained. I've had it for a few months and basically just cleaned it up a bit. It had an older restoration sometime in the mid-late 1990s and has been kept garaged and used on occasion. This is what a Mach I convertible would have looked like, had Ford actually made such a model during any of its 69-73 run. Down to the correct polished aluminum wheels. Very reliable car that starts right up and will drive anywhere. Interior is in GOOD condition with minor general wear here and there. Seats are nice with minor wear and a small rip on driver's side lower left shoulder. Carpet is worn but presentable. Dash pad is good with one slight crack down the middle. Door panels in good shape with some wear by armrest areas. Good steering wheel. Convertible top is very good with NO rips (rear glass window needs to be resealed as it's coming loose). Overall a nicely presentable driver quality interior! Under the hood lies the stock MATCHING NUMBERS F-CODE 302ci 2V motor which is 100% bone stock from the looks of it. Starts easily and sounds great with minor exhaust leak . Good stock power overall and brakes stop VERY WELL. Nice and solid throughout. Steering is nice and nimble. Very fun to drive and you can hop in and drive it right now without worries, just tune it the way you want and you're ready to go. I've driven it mostly around town here and there, and a few times on the highway on the way to a local cruise night or car show, never on any long trips. Underside looks very presentable on this car. Has had frame connectors welded to the frame for better structural rigidity. Looks like the entire underside was undercoated some time ago as well. Good floors with no big rust holes that I was able to see. Frame rails appear to be pretty decent overall. Shock towers and torque boxes still in one piece. Trunk pan has had some small patches and looks solid but could use detailing. Overall better than your average completely rusted out mustang underside in my opinion Being an old car, it is NOT perfect by any means. Paint shines up NICELY with good luster for a presentable driver (NOT a showcar of course). Some minor imperfections here and there from use as you would expect like chips/small scratches/dings etc. Doors may need minot adjustment as the gaps are a little wide. Clutch travel is pretty high and although it shifts well I would eventually change it to be on the safe side. Rear bumper could use replacing. May need a couple of bulbs replaced and one or two of the smaller gauges not working well. That's about all I was able to notice from my inspection.
